The performance SUV sector is booming. But with high performance, more often than not, comes a high price tag, too. However, there are some used examples which offer all the thrills of a performance SUV at a fraction of the price. Here, we’re looking at some of the best for under £25,000.
What are the best used sports SUVs for under £25,000?
- Audi SQ5
- Volkswagen T-Roc R-Line
- SEAT Arona FR Sport
- BMW X5 M50d
- Range Rover Sport 5.0-litre
- Volkswagen Touareg V10 TDI
Audi SQ5
Audi’s SQ5 was one of the first all-rounder sports SUVs. Its latest SQ5 boasts an impressive 341PS and thanks to its 3.0 V6 TDI engine, the Audi SQ5 from 0-62mph in just 5.1 seconds. Now if the newer model is a bit out of your price bracket at over £55,000, We think a used SQ5 would tick all the right boxes. The SQ5 has been around since 2013 and was the first Audi S model to feature a diesel engine and has had great success, rivalling against Porsche Cayenne, BMW X5 and Mercedes-Benz ML63 AMG.
Of course, being an Audi, quality was rock-solid with the SQ5, while residuals have remained strong owing to that premium badge and the car’s excellent performance. Even so, you should still be able to nab a tidy example of some of the older models for under our £25,000 budget.

BMW X5 M50d
BMW’s X5 has been a mainstay in the SUV segment for some time now. And, like the car with the three-pronged star, there’s a performance version of it too, for those who like to sit up high but go quickly too.
Called the X5 M50d, early variants were powered by a beefy 3.0-litre straight-six diesel – the 5 on the back paid no relevance to engine size on this occasion, unfortunately. That said, it still represents great value for money, with plenty of options for under £25,000.
Range Rover Sport 5.0-litre
Range Rover’s first-generation Sport was a more dynamic take on the well-known off-roader. It combined the luxurious edge associated with the brand together with a more road-orientated dynamic setup.
It could also be fitted with a supercharged 5.0-litre V8, giving the Range Rover Sport monstrous performance as well as a raucous soundtrack. And guess what? You can get used examples for well under our £25,000 budget.
Volkswagen Touareg V10 TDI
A V10-powered VW SUV may sound absolutely ludicrous, and to be quite honest, it is, but Volkswagen made one and we’re grateful for it.
The Touareg V10 didn’t just use any 10-cylinder engine though, rather an unconventional diesel-powered unit. The result is masses of torque low in the rev range — ideal for spooking a supercar or two.
